A bubble-gum pop singer in the 1980s, Tiffany had several Top 40 hits.
Now, she's turned to country music after a failed R&B album.
Her father was born in Tebnine, Lebanon, and came to the U.S. as a small child. Her mother, whose family is from California and Arkansas, has English, Irish, Welsh, and German ancestry.
An aunt became her legal guardian until she turned 18 after having been
denied legal emancipation.
She was discovered singing country music at age 11 or 12 on a country
music show by producer George Tobin, who became her manager.
